Judicial and Law Notices. NOTICE. WHEREAS by deed of mortgage dated on or about the Ist aav of July ISG9 made between Joseph Culliford therein described of the one part and James Edwin Graham therein also described of tho other part certain leasehold property situated in Colombo and Cashel streets Christchurch comprising a butcher's shnp now in the occupation of the said Joseph Culliford and being portion of Town Reserve No 844 was duly executed by the said Joseph Culliford and now stands "security to the said James Edwin Graham for the sum of two hundred and fifty pounds or thereabouts balance of the principal money originally advanced thereon And whereas the said deed has been neglected to be registered and the possession thereof was some time since obtained from the said James Edwin Graham and whereas since the recent application of the said James Edwin Graham to the Supreme Court in the matter of the said mortgage deed and other title deeds in relation thereto the undersigned have obtained additional eridence as to the actual custody of the said deeds and the circumstances under which the same were obtained from the said James Edwin Graham and are now held but some time must necessarily elapse before further proceedings in relation thereto can be taken Now all persons are hereby cautioned against parting with or accepting the possession of or in any way dealing with the said mortgage or other deeds or any of them. SLATER & SON, Solicitors for the said James Edwiu Graham. 8-29 1099 IN BANKRUPTCY. RICHARD WALTON, 8-28 1086 Trustee. Partnership Noties. NOTICE IS HEREBY GIVEN that the PARTNERSHIP hitherto subsisting between ns. the undersigned WILLIAM HOBBS, WILLIAM ALFRED HOBBS, and FREDERICK HOBBS, carrying on business at Christchurch and Timaru, in the Province of Canterbury, as Tailors and Woollen Drapers, under the style or firm of " Hobbs and Sons," has this day been DISSOLVED by mutual consent. Dated this 24th day of August, 1872. The Christchurch branch will be carried on by FREDERICK HOBBS, under the name of " Hobbs and Co.; " and the Timaru branch by WILLIAM ALFRED HOBBS, on their respective and separate accounts. All DEBTS due to and owing by the Christchurch branch of the late business will be paid and received by FREDERICK HOBBS ; and those of the Timaru branch by the said WILLIAM ALFRED HOBBS. WILLIAM HOBBS, WILLIAM ALFRED HOBBS, FKEDK. HOBBS. Witness to the signatures of William Hobbs, William Alfred Ilobbs, and Frederick Hobbs, . George W. Naldeb, Solicitor, Christchurch.
